Understanding Human Memory and Its Inspiration for Modern AI Memory Systems

Memory is the cornerstone of cognition, enabling organisms to learn, adapt, and navigate complex environments. At its core, human memory operates through interconnected systems—sensory, short-term, and long-term memory—each governed by distinct neural mechanisms. The hippocampus plays a pivotal role in consolidating sensory input into lasting memories, while the prefrontal cortex supports executive functions like working memory and retrieval. Biological memory relies on synaptic plasticity, where repeated neural activation strengthens connections, a process governed by molecular changes such as long-term potentiation (LTP).

How Human Memory Encodes, Stores, and Retrieves Information

Encoding transforms sensory data into neural patterns through patterns of synaptic firing. For instance, recognizing a face involves integrating visual, auditory, and emotional inputs into a coherent neural representation. Consolidation stabilizes these memories over time, often enhanced during sleep when hippocampal-neocortical dialogue strengthens memory traces. Retrieval accesses stored information via cues—contextual, emotional, or sensory—though it remains prone to distortion due to the reconstructive nature of recall.

Biologically, memory formation depends on dynamic changes at synapses, where neurotransmitter release and receptor sensitivity shift in response to experience. The hippocampus acts as a temporary buffer, orchestrating memory integration before long-term storage in distributed cortical networks. Retrieval success hinges on pattern completion, where partial cues reactivate complex neural ensembles—a process mirrored in AI through attention and context encoding.

Despite its robustness, human memory is inherently fallible. It suffers from forgetting, influenced by decay and interference, and exhibits systematic biases. Confirmation bias leads individuals to strengthen memories aligning with prior beliefs; hindsight bias distorts recollection by making past events seem predictable; and emotional intensity can both enhance and warp memory accuracy.

Capacity limits further constrain memory: short-term storage holds only 5–9 items for ~20 seconds, while long-term capacity is vast but subject to gradual decay without reinforcement.

Limitations and Biases in Human Memory

Human memory is remarkably malleable, shaped by context, emotion, and cognition. Emotional arousal, mediated by the amygdala, can intensify memory consolidation—favoring survival-relevant events—but may also distort details through heightened attention to central features at the expense of peripheral ones.

  • Confirmation Bias: People selectively encode and recall information supporting pre-existing views, reinforcing existing neural pathways.
  • Hindsight Bias: After an outcome is known, individuals misremember earlier beliefs as more aligned with the result, altering neural memory traces retroactively.
  • Capacity Constraints: Limited short-term bandwidth means only a fraction of sensory input is consciously processed, with selective attention pruning irrelevant data.
  • Long-Term Decay: Without rehearsal or retrieval, synaptic connections weaken, leading to forgetting.

“Memory is not a recording; it is reconstruction shaped by context, emotion, and later knowledge.” — cognitive neuroscience insight

The Science Behind Modern AI Memory Systems

Artificial neural networks emulate biological memory through adjustable weights and activation patterns. Each connection between neurons is assigned a weight reflecting the strength of influence—analogous to synaptic efficacy. During training, these weights are updated via gradient descent, mimicking synaptic plasticity by minimizing prediction errors over time.

Backpropagation, the algorithm that adjusts weights backward through the network, draws a conceptual parallel to consolidation—biological memory stabilization through repeated reactivation and refinement. Experience replay in AI, where past data batches are revisited during training, mirrors the hippocampus’s role in memory reactivation during sleep, enhancing robustness and generalization.

Memory-augmented architectures extend these principles. Differentiable Neural Computers (DNCs) integrate external memory matrices accessible via attention, emulating working memory by selectively retrieving and updating stored facts. Similarly, transformer models use multi-head attention to focus on relevant input segments—resembling selective human attention during encoding and retrieval.

From Neuroscience to Cognitive-Inspired AI

Modern AI systems increasingly adopt neuroplasticity principles. Adaptive learning rates, for example, reflect biological mechanisms where synaptic strength changes gradually through use and rest. Just as repeated exposure strengthens memory traces, AI models apply gradual parameter updates, avoiding abrupt shifts that destabilize learning.

Attention mechanisms in transformers directly emulate selective human focus. By weighting input elements differently based on relevance, these models replicate the brain’s ability to prioritize salient cues during encoding and retrieval—enhancing efficiency and accuracy.

Memory pruning strategies in AI systems draw from the forgetting curve, intentionally weakening less relevant connections to reduce noise and improve performance. This mirrors biological forgetting, which clears outdated information to maintain system efficiency.

Critical Considerations and Ethical Dimensions

AI memory systems, though inspired by biology, introduce new ethical challenges. Unlike biological memory’s opaque neural dynamics, AI memory traces are often inscrutable black boxes—raising concerns about transparency and accountability.

Data privacy is paramount: storing and retrieving information in AI must ensure user consent and secure handling, especially in sensitive domains like healthcare or finance. Without robust safeguards, memory systems risk misuse or unintended bias reproduction.

Avoiding the replication of human memory biases is essential. If AI learns from flawed or biased data, it risks amplifying confirmation bias or hindsight distortion—undermining fairness and trust. Designing bias-mitigating memory architectures remains a critical frontier.
